Easyelectronics.ru

Электроника для всех
Текущее время: 28 апр 2017, 07:24

Часовой пояс: UTC + 5 часов



    • Изготовление печатных плат. Примерные цены: 10 штук 2-слоя 100*100mm 8.21$ или около ~470 рублей
    • Создание принципиальных схем и проектирование печатных плат
    • Симуляция работы на spice моделях
    • Просмотр GERBER файлов

Начать новую тему Ответить на тему  [ Сообщений: 8 ] 
Автор Сообщение
 Заголовок сообщения: Не удается запустить AT91SAM7S
СообщениеДобавлено: 11 фев 2011, 22:21 
Только пришел

Зарегистрирован: 29 авг 2010, 23:56
Сообщения: 24
Для микроконтроллера AT91SAM7S128(arm7) я сделал отладочную платку. При подачи питания МК не стартует - на ножке NRST(reset) низкий уровень(~0,9В). На выводах кварца никаких колебаний нет. Питание на всех выводах есть, внутренний стабилизатор выдает 1,8 вольт. Во вложениях схема.


Вложения:
Комментарий к файлу: Схема вся
P-CAD EDA - [Sheet1].pdf [46.89 Кб]
Скачиваний: 337
Комментарий к файлу: Подключение кварца
Crystall.PNG
Crystall.PNG [ 16.63 Кб | Просмотров: 9241 ]
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Не удается запустить AT91SAM7S
СообщениеДобавлено: 12 фев 2011, 19:36 
Старожил
Аватара пользователя

Зарегистрирован: 29 янв 2010, 15:41
Сообщения: 873
Откуда: Германия
Если на ножке NRESET низкий уровень, значит не пропаяно где то, либо залипло на землю где то.
Потом, как с этой ножкой разберетесь, попробуйте поставить перемычку на ERASE, включить на пару секунд, выключить, убрать перемычку и снова завести.
А вообще - там не все кварцы с этим процом работают, как я поянл из форумов. Мой AT91SAM7SE256 тоже не захотел заводиться от кварца. От внутренного RC колебатора или от внешнего генератора - наура. А вот открварцев - нивкакую. Причем от разных, которые были у меня в наличие.

_________________
Мои поделки
http://www.fun-electronic.net/


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Не удается запустить AT91SAM7S
СообщениеДобавлено: 12 фев 2011, 20:40 
Старожил

Зарегистрирован: 29 янв 2010, 00:34
Сообщения: 818
Откуда: Санкт-Петербург
@ MasterAlexei
Там еще в еррате есть баг по поводу Master Clock Selection регистра
http://www.atmel.com/dyn/resources/prod ... oc6173.pdf
Может с этим связано. Или с последовательностью инициализации (я с STM32 долго мудохался, потом понял, что на вход PLL частоту надо подавать только после конфигурации и старта самой PLL)


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Не удается запустить AT91SAM7S
СообщениеДобавлено: 12 фев 2011, 22:16 
Старожил
Аватара пользователя

Зарегистрирован: 29 янв 2010, 15:41
Сообщения: 873
Откуда: Германия
A-10 писал(а):
@ MasterAlexei
Там еще в еррате есть баг по поводу Master Clock Selection регистра
http://www.atmel.com/dyn/resources/prod ... oc6173.pdf
Может с этим связано. Или с последовательностью инициализации (я с STM32 долго мудохался, потом понял, что на вход PLL частоту надо подавать только после конфигурации и старта самой PLL)

О как.
Ну тот регистр, что в ерате описан - MCKR, я так и программлю, но намного позже, чем PLL завожу.

А вот PLL я завожу, когда уже включил осциллятор. Очень даже может быть, что именно в этом проблема.
Но сейчас перепаивать все уже не хочу, чтобы проверять, так как я очень основательно генератор на платку прилепил.

_________________
Мои поделки
http://www.fun-electronic.net/


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Не удается запустить AT91SAM7S
СообщениеДобавлено: 23 окт 2011, 10:28 
Только пришел

Зарегистрирован: 21 янв 2011, 21:47
Сообщения: 27
В наличии плата с at91sam7s256 с обвязкой для юсб. Цепляю перемычку на test, жду 10 секунд, убираю перемычку, после чего sam-ba видит плату. Заливаю bin-файл во флеш (самба говорит, что успешно), и ничего не происходит. Пробовал отключить/включить питание, подать на ресет 0В, все безуспешно. Подскажите, что я делаю не так?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Тактовый генератор для AT91SAM7.... и не только.
СообщениеДобавлено: 03 дек 2012, 20:38 
Только пришел

Зарегистрирован: 23 май 2012, 08:50
Сообщения: 17
Делаю небольшую платку с AT91SAM7X256, и двумя ATMega8, тактовую частоту хочу всем дать 18.432МГц (чтобы USB можно было заюзать), но почитав посты выше, в затруднении с источником тактирования. Сначала думал кварц подключить к 91-му, и усилив сигнал с него полевым транзистором, раздать его на XTAL1-входы обоих мег. Теперь склоняюсь к мысли, что надежней отдельного внешнего генератора ничего быть не может. Как его лучше/дешевле построить? Поискать простые логические элементы 2И-НЕ с рабочей частотой выше 20МГц и сделать примитивный генератор на трех таких элементах, или использовать специализированную ИМС?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Не удается запустить AT91SAM7S
СообщениеДобавлено: 31 мар 2013, 12:34 
Здравствуйте!

Зарегистрирован: 30 мар 2013, 21:19
Сообщения: 3
Всем привет!
Что-то в теме давно не общался - у всех все разрешилось само собой?
У меня проблема с запуском ARM7.
Есть отладочная плата SAM7-P64 (http://www.olimex.com/Products/ARM/Atmel/SAM7-P64/), с камнем AT91SAM7s64
переходник USB-COM RS232 (http://www.masterkit.ru/main/set.php?code_id=214386) и ARM-JTAG программатор-отладчик (им пока не пользовался).
В итоге хочу зацепить на вход АЦП сигнал от AV камеры (один кадр) и анализировать простым масочным алгоритмом.
Но пока не могу подключить плату через SAM-BA v2.12, что бы ни пробовал результат один: "Communication error".
Тут подглядел про перемычки, глянул в мануал, попробовал переключать: TST, перемычки последовательного порта, - но результат один.
Что можно сделать и как вообще по грамоте запускать эту плату. А так же буду признателен за ссылки на адекватную вопросу информацию.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Не удается запустить AT91SAM7S
СообщениеДобавлено: 31 мар 2013, 13:10 
Здравствуйте!

Зарегистрирован: 30 мар 2013, 21:19
Сообщения: 3
Подключил через USB без проблем. Видимо с последних моих изысканий забыл перемычки обратно перекинуть.
Но через COM RS232 все равно не получается.
Кто-нибудь пробовал JTAG с переходником LPT-USB? Говорят что штука не надежная получается.


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 8 ] 

Часовой пояс: UTC + 5 часов


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B